Full Job Description

đź“‹ Description

  • • As the Customer Education and Communities Manager at Kustomer, you will build and own a net-new function within the CX organization, designing and running programs that help customers, partners, and the community get maximum value from the platform—accelerating time-to-value, improving retention, and enabling the partner ecosystem to scale.
  • • You will centralize customer onboarding content, partner-facing resources, and community management; drive product adoption through targeted content and in-product education; partner with internal teams on product curriculum; and track enablement analytics to prove ROI and iterate on programs.
  • • You will operate as a senior individual contributor reporting to the Chief Revenue Officer, leveraging AI tooling and automation to produce content, manage community, and run analytics at scale—functioning as a one-person team with the impact of a larger enablement function.
  • • You will have the autonomy to design how the function runs, access to AI tooling budget, and direct visibility to leadership accountable for outcomes in product adoption, time-to-value, and gross revenue retention.

🎯 Requirements

  • • 5+ years in customer enablement, customer education, partner enablement, or a closely related function at a B2B SaaS company
  • • Demonstrated experience building enablement programs from scratch (not only executing within an established function)
  • • Strong product instincts—ability to learn a complex platform deeply and translate technical capability into customer-facing value
  • • Fluency with AI tooling for content generation, knowledge management, and workflow automation, including building workflows with measurable outcomes
  • • Excellent writing and content design skills—ability to produce polished, customer-facing material independently
  • • Comfort with analytics and reporting on adoption, engagement, and ROI metrics

About Kustomer Inc.

Kustomer Inc. provides cloud-based customer service software that unifies interactions, tickets, orders, and customer data into a single timeline. Agents access a 360-degree view, automation handles repetitive tasks, and AI delivers insights and suggested responses. The platform supports omnichannel communication across email, chat, social, voice, SMS, and WhatsApp, and offers CRM, workflow, and reporting tools for e-commerce, marketplaces, and digital-first brands.
